Courses and Programmes

Our programmes and courses are available to all our partners and customers, as well as the wider community, as part of the portfolio of high-quality services delivered within our ports. Examples of some of the courses we offer are:

  • Appointed Person
  • First Aid at Work
  • Fire Marshall
  • Risk Assessment
  • Institute of Occupational Safety (IOSH) Working Safely
  • IOSH Managing Safely
  • Confined Space
  • Lift Supervisor
  • Plant – various
  • Construction Design Management (CDM)
  • Accredited RTITB Forklift Truck and Reach Truck training
